Meaning 1

To disinfect, purify, or rid of vermin with the fumes of certain chemicals.

History

Etymology

First attested in 1530; borrowed from Latin fūmigātus, perfect passive participle of fūmigō (see -ate (verb-forming suffix)), from fūmus (“smoke”).
